This manuscript is the 15th of 25 volumes titled “Kin Ko Ki Ko An.” It is a folk tale that tells the story of Goa He Yang recalling his past when he saw a hole near his house, filled with memories from his childhood.

Other notes:
- The writing is dominated by the Lontarak Makassarese script, with some characters modified by Liem Kheng Yong, and features a combination with Hanzi.
- Initially, this manuscript was rented out to the Peranakan Chinese community.
- It is adapted from a Chinese folk legend.
- There is a red stamp of the author that reads: “LIEM KHENG YONG-MAKASSAR.”
